This week on Death is Everything we look at the creation of the Panama Canal, one of the world’s greatest feats of engineering, and the sizable human toll that went into its construction. We give our gratitude to the many thousands of laborers that died braving the snakes, mosquitoes, diseases, explosions, and countless workplace and environmental dangers to bring us this crucial piece of infrastructure. The next time you make a purchase made possible through the seemingly magical advances of global shipping, give a thought to the sacrifices of the many people who have made our way of life possible. Then stick around to hear an update on the state of the Darien Gap, the treacherous stretch of land that serves as a route for immigrants looking for a better life.
